Output d64908c37bfe7318c4eefd4455ef96dfa6bfef37e605f9c1dabf61e707e9ed51:20

value
510649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2668c4f351c18a3395765d0a0da2ea2f7e5be2e5 OP_EQUAL
address
35C77LMZe1Rod8uhg6WwaBRmmExwjy11qx
transaction
d64908c37bfe7318c4eefd4455ef96dfa6bfef37e605f9c1dabf61e707e9ed51
spent
true